🔍 黑暗爆料社交平台的技术架构设计 🔍
黑暗爆料社交平台作为一个特殊的信息分享渠道,其技术架构设计需要充分考虑用户隐私保护、信息安全传输和内容审核等多个关键要素。平台采用分布式微服务架构,通过Docker容器化部署确保系统的高可用性和弹性扩展能力。
🛡️ 用户数据安全防护机制 🛡️
用户数据加密存储采用AES-256位加密算法,所有敏感信息经过多重加密后再进行传输。平台引入区块链技术记录信息发布轨迹,建立不可篡改的数据链条。用户注册采用双因素认证,登录时需要进行生物特征验证,有效防止账号被盗用。
🤖 智能内容审核系统 🤖
平台开发了基于深度学习的智能内容审核系统,通过自然语言处理技术对发布内容进行实时分析。系统能够识别违法违规、人身攻击等不当信息,准确率达到98%。同时建立用户信用评分机制,对恶意发布者实施账号限制。
⚡ 高性能消息推送架构 ⚡
消息推送系统基于Redis集群构建,采用发布订阅模式实现实时通知。通过Kafka消息队列处理高并发场景,单机支持10万用户同时在线。系统还集成了ElasticSearch搜索引擎,支持毫秒级的全文检索。
📱 移动端适配优化 📱
移动客户端采用Flutter跨平台开发框架,实现iOS和Android双端统一。使用WebSocket长连接技术保持实时通信,网络不稳定情况下自动重连。图片上传采用分片传输,支持断点续传,极大提升用户体验。